The IC754VSI06MTD General Electric GE QuickPanel is an operator panel that allows the users to interface with their machine in a simple way. This operator terminal has a monochrome display and a 6-inch display size. This QuickPanel makes it possible for the user to perform connections while using the RS485 and RS232 communication ports with an HMI-CAB-C120 communication cable. Through this is an operator terminal, the user can input information and data while controlling the HMI by using the touchscreen. This unit has an input power of 12 to 30 Volts DC. The IC754VSI06MTD has 32 MB of internal memory. This HMI exhibits the Proficiency View Machine Edition software type.
Depending on the model, the IC754VSI06MTD QuickPanel View terminal can have a monochrome display as stated in the previous paragraph or it can have an integrated flat-panel color model. The color model uses passive STN technology, it is backlit, and it measures 5.7 inches diagonally. This model has a backlight timer. The backlight life can be extended by automatically turning off the backlight. The user needs to activate the touchscreen before using it. Even though users can activate it with their fingers, the most recommended tool for activation is a blunt stylus. The IC754VSI06MTD QuickPanel View terminal can also be configured so that it can also use a software emulation keyboard as an operator data input device. The soft input panel that it has can be used in place of a hardware keyboard because it is a touchscreen version of a standard keyboard. An icon that is located on the system tray allows the user to hide or view the SIP. The following steps can be followed to display the soft input panel icon in the system tray; the input panel in the control panel should be double-tapped. To change the input panel state check box, the user has to select the allowed applications by selecting or clearing the show input panel in system tray box, tapping “okay,” and lastly by running the backup to save the settings.
